Vendor note for new team members: canary gating on the Bramblewick platform is enforced by our vendor, Opaline Systems, not by us. Their Gatewright tool holds each canary at 5% traffic until error rate, latency p95, and saturation all pass for 30 minutes. We cannot override the hold; only Opaline's release desk can. Document any gating dispute in the vendor log before requesting an exception. For exception requests, write to their release desk directly.

alerts address for bahaf-kaduf: zorox@qorvelio.internal

Subject: Quickstore 4.2 — bloom filter now fronts the KV layer

Plugin authors: starting with this release, Quickstore places a bloom filter ahead of the key-value store. Negative lookups return faster; false positives fall through safely. No API changes are required on your side. Verify your plugin against the staging build referenced below.

session token of fahif-tadup = htk3_9c7

## Deploying the Gatewick Proctor Queue

Deploys are pretty painless: push to main, wait for the pipeline, then watch the queue drain dashboard for five minutes. If candidates pile up mid-exam, roll back first and ask questions later — the queue replays safely. Everything the workers care about lives in one config block, shown here for reference.

settings of bafof-yagef:
JOROX_PIN=8740
JOROX_TENANT=pelox
JOROX_METRICS_HOST=metrics.jorox.qorvelworks.internal
JOROX_SEAL=seal_c78f63c1
JOROX_STANDBY_TEAM=norax

Ticket PROC-412: the credentials vault for the Tallgrove exam-proctoring queue is locked after three failed rotation attempts. Workers can't fetch session tokens, so proctoring jobs are parking in the retry lane — no data loss, but the queue is growing. The rotation script in queue/rotate.py needs review before we retry; I suspect it sends the old token twice. Once the fix lands, the vault can be reopened using the recovery passphrase noted below.

strongbox words: zorath-holmir